Java Developer with Angular
Java Developer with AngularAustin, TX - Onsite JobJob SummaryWe are looking for a skilled Java Developer with Angular experience to design, develop, and maintain scalable web applications. The ideal candidate should be strong in backend development using Java technologies and capable of building responsive, user-friendly front-end applications with Angular.Key ResponsibilitiesDesign, develop, and maintain backend services using Java (Spring, Spring Boot)Build dynamic, responsive front-end applications using AngularDevelop RESTful APIs and integrate them with front-end componentsWrite clean, efficient, and well-documented codeCollaborate with cross-functional teams (UI/UX, QA, DevOps)Perform unit testing, debugging, and performance optimizationParticipate in code reviews and follow best coding practicesWork with databases and ensure data integrity and securityRequired Skills & QualificationsStrong experience in Java (Java 8+)Hands-on experience with Spring, Spring Boot, Hibernate/JPAProficiency in Angular (v8+ preferred)Good knowledge of HTML, CSS, TypeScript, JavaScriptExperience building and consuming REST APIsFamiliarity with SQL/NoSQL databases (MySQL, PostgreSQL, MongoDB, etc.)Understanding of Git , CI/CD pipelines, and Agile methodologiesPreferred Skills (Nice to Have)Experience with microservices architectureKnowledge of Docker, KubernetesExposure to cloud platforms (AWS, Azure, GCP)Experience with security standards (OAuth, JWT)Education & ExperienceBachelor's degree in Computer Science or related field